Breakside Brewery

Back to the Future IPA

Breakside Brewing/Fremont Brewing Back to the Future IPA. The similarly named beer put out by Fremont in May during Seattle Beer Week had Jarrylo & Equinox hops. This version released by Breakside for Portland Beer Week has Azacca & Ella hops. New, experimental hop varietals in each. Both really good and distinct hop notes, although prefer the Fremont release as less sweet. — 10 years ago
